The Los Angeles Lakers leaned heavily on Rui Hachimura throughout the regular season, as he averaged 13.1 points and 5.0 rebounds per game, shooting 50.9% from the field over 68 appearances. Known for his efficient scoring and perimeter shooting ability, Hachimura emerged as a key starting player next to superstars LeBron James and Luka Doncic.

The Oklahoma City Thunder tied up the 2025 NBA Finals with a dominant 123-107 Game 2 win over the Indiana Pacers on Sunday. OKC bounced back from a stunning Game 1 loss, in which the Pacers erased a 15-point fourth-quarter deficit.
